The guided wave NDT reported in this paper is typical of the best application of the technique in the field. The technique has been developed for screening, and critically has to be followed by local testing at the locations where indications are called. In this case, the application of the screening had to be done in challenging circumstances. The guided wave measurements were planned and executed very thoroughly, using the necessary advanced features of the equipment and procedures. But equally importantly, follow-up testing was performed and recorded rigorously. Where indications were called, new test boxes were installed to investigate in detail. These were costly decisions, based solely and honestly on the interpretation of the guided wave signals. The follow-up included thorough visual mark up of corroded areas, prolific photographic records, and thickness mapping by profilometer and ultrasonic thickness gaging. In cases where other concerns were noted, alternative conventional methods were applied, too: liquid penetrant, magnetic particle and radiographic testing. The results were used to check compliance against integrity calculations and codes of practice, and thus to inform decisions on repair and monitoring. As a result of this follow-up, the records of the testing now include a detailed survey of the line, showing the locations of welds, remaining concrete cover, repairs and anomalies to be monitored.
